Transaction 0077dfabaa08b9364e7222faf914170453495c821a52826012e46cc03f9a15f1
1 Input
2 Outputs
- 0077dfabaa08b9364e7222faf914170453495c821a52826012e46cc03f9a15f1:0
- 0077dfabaa08b9364e7222faf914170453495c821a52826012e46cc03f9a15f1:1
value 107975
address 3EwScuhEdyREmmuXt94gHtZAU3GhM71gJy
value 11834993
address 1KHEhqVbZjMwHcepW4rwANFjW1qbZjVhVz